MÔ TẢ CÔNG VIỆC
Coordinate annual food & beverage promotions with Sales & Marketing and property management; measure success.
Analyze and set food cost standards per resort.
Oversee menu quality, food & beverage costs, service delivery, training, cleanliness, and SOE quality.
Set brand standards for restaurant and banquet menus, including quality, variety, creativity, and presentation.
Collaborate with Kitchen team for seasonal menu changes, recipes, costing, and test cooking.
Ensure food preparation follows recipes and presentation standards.
Structure consolidated purchasing agreements for cost savings with Group Purchasing.
Inspect produce quality and liaise with finance and purchasing departments.
Review and improve receiving, handling, and storage processes for food produce.
Act on guest feedback and brand audit reports.
Maintain and upgrade quality levels in production, presentation, food cost, cleanliness, and hygiene.
Ensure adherence to food safety practices.
Develop and plan new hotel operations, ensuring proper restaurant and kitchen setup.
Participate in pre-opening project planning and support.
Develop staffing guides for new projects.
Supervise F&B hosts, facilities, sales, and costs for maximum profit.
Liaise with guests to meet their F&B requirements.
Ensure thorough knowledge of menus and wine lists.
Oversee efficient service in all outlets and accurate guest charges.
Control loss, waste, and breakage of ingredients and equipment.
Prepare monthly reports on service, breakage, loss, and inventories.
Lead by example in maintaining F&B standards.
Conduct regular staff meetings to improve service and morale.
Provide monthly and on-job training to subordinates.
Ensure guests are greeted according to standards.
Ensure guest comfort and satisfaction throughout service.
Handle problems and guest complaints efficiently.
Manage shift closure and checkout.
Follow and enforce opening and closing checklists.
Assign preparation tasks for the next shift as needed.
